Gary O'Neil confirms Wolverhampton Wanderers plans to sign new forward

Head coach Gary O'Neil confirms that Wolverhampton Wanderers hope to sign a new centre-forward during the January transfer window.

Head coach Gary O'Neil has confirmed that Wolverhampton Wanderers will enter the transfer market for a new forward in January.

On Wednesday night, Wolves produced a ruthless performance to post a 4-1 victory away at Brentford to see the club return to 11th position in the Premier League standings.

The West Midlands outfit have now scored in all but two of their top-flight fixtures this season, only failing to net away at Manchester United and West Ham United.

However, changes to the squad have been anticipated for some time with top goalscorer Hwang Hee-chan due to represent South Korea in the Asia Cup in January.

His form and that of Matheus Cunha has meant that Sasa Kalajdzic and Fabio Silva have seen their game time heavily restricted since the start of August.

Reports have indicated that Wolves have been scouring the market in the hope of identifying a new addition for their frontline next month.

O'Neil has now acknowledged that will be the case, also suggesting that another left-sided player may be considered courtesy of Rayan Ait-Nouri linking up with Algeria for the Africa Cup of Nations.

Speaking to Amazon Prime Video, the Englishman said: "We will try to do some stuff, definitely, because Channy and Sasa are our only nines really, and Channy is not really a nine. We use him as a nine because we are a little bit short there.

"He is going to go away on international duty, Rayan will be away, so there is a little bit that we need to do, of course. But it will be within what is right for the club, maybe a few going out."

Hwang has put himself in the conversation for Player of the Year in the Premier League, with each of his 10 goals and two assists coming in separate matches until he contributed a double versus Brentford.

The likelihood is that a permanent or temporary transfer will be found for Silva, who has not featured since November 9 and has already been linked with a number of foreign clubs.

Despite scoring winning goals against Everton and Bournemouth, the future of Kalajdzic will also come into question having accumulated just 282 minutes of football in all competitions during 2023-24.
